Transaction 121ae83d201ff5201b73105d41fc25669da8e1e1ceac49e0421a4a9415fdde63
1 Input
2 Outputs
- 121ae83d201ff5201b73105d41fc25669da8e1e1ceac49e0421a4a9415fdde63:0
- 121ae83d201ff5201b73105d41fc25669da8e1e1ceac49e0421a4a9415fdde63:1
value 510271458
address 19beBRxH4H8dSrF2zfJh6oXafVAz84kJLp
value 10020000
address 33cdEoVgZj3ajtyuhbUQExvskUK74fDGwN